A Certificate Programme in Cyber Forensics and Cyber Attacks equips participants with the crucial skills needed to investigate and respond to digital security breaches. The program focuses on practical application, enabling students to analyze malware, understand attack vectors, and perform incident response activities.
Learning outcomes include mastering digital forensics techniques, such as evidence collection and analysis. Students will also gain expertise in network security, intrusion detection, and vulnerability assessment. This practical, hands-on training provides a strong foundation in cybersecurity incident management and response for various organizations.
The program's duration typically ranges from a few weeks to several months, depending on the intensity and specific modules included. This flexible timeframe allows professionals to upskill or reskill efficiently, fitting the training around existing commitments.
This Certificate Programme in Cyber Forensics and Cyber Attacks holds significant industry relevance. Graduates are prepared for roles in various sectors experiencing high demand for skilled cybersecurity professionals. This includes positions such as security analyst, incident responder, penetration tester, and digital forensics investigator, reflecting the growing need for professionals skilled in combating cyber threats. The program's focus on both offensive and defensive cyber security ensures a holistic understanding of the field.
The curriculum often incorporates real-world case studies and simulations, mimicking the challenges faced by cybersecurity professionals daily. This approach emphasizes practical experience and prepares graduates for immediate employment in the field of computer forensics and incident response.

A Certificate Programme in Cyber Forensics and Cyber Attacks is increasingly significant in today's UK market, reflecting the growing threat landscape. The UK experienced a 39% increase in cybercrime reports between 2021 and 2022, according to the National Crime Agency. This surge underlines the critical need for skilled professionals in cyber security, driving demand for certified experts in cyber forensics and cyber attack response. The increasing sophistication of cyber threats, from ransomware attacks to data breaches, necessitate professionals proficient in investigating digital crimes and mitigating future incidents. Such programmes equip individuals with the practical skills and theoretical knowledge required to analyze digital evidence, identify vulnerabilities, and implement robust security measures.
